Abstract

The invention discloses nutrient soil suitable for non-woven fabric seedling culture of celtis sinensis and a manufacturing method thereof. Compared with the prior art, the nutrient soil suitable for non-woven fabric seedling culture of the celtis sinensis and the manufacturing method thereof have the advantages that the formula of the nutrient soil is reasonable and comprehensive, and the nutrient soil keeps highly effective in 95% of the area where the nutrient soil is applied, and can be absorbed by surrounding roots and rapidly promote seed germination and seedling growth; the nutrient soil can nourish the roots of seedlings for a long time and has the effects of strengthening the seedlings of the celtis sinensis, promoting the seedlings to root rapidly and resisting diseases and insect pests for the seedlings; the method for culturing the celtis sinensis through the nutrient soil is simple, the cost is low, the nutrient soil is convenient to apply, and therefore popularization is easy.

Technical field
The present invention relates to the planting technology of beech trees, especially relate to a kind of Nutrition Soil that beech tree non-woven fabrics grows seedlings and preparation method thereof that is applicable to.
Background technology
Beech trees (Celtis sinensis) are Ulmaceae common tree, Ye Shi China endemic species, mainly be distributed in the ground such as Anhui, Jiangsu, Fujian, Henan, Sichuan and Taiwan, beech tree tree height is large, grand, tree crown broadness, tree-like attractive in appearance, the green shade is thick, after growing up, quite can demonstrate simple and unsophisticated tree performance style and features, for having good shade tree, shade tree, the entourage tree of potentiality in gardens construction; Beech tree happiness light, drought-enduring, not tight to soil requirement, ecological suitability is strong.In addition, beech tree also has stronger resistance to the toxic gas such as sulfurous gas, chlorine.The stem micromicro of beech tree is with papermaking with for the production of artificial cotton, and fruit can be made lubricating oil, and Recent study also finds that the compound separating from the extract of its branch has antitumor and effect anti-inflammatory.Both at home and abroad the research of beech tree is mainly concentrated on introduce a fine variety, grow seedlings, the research of the aspect such as afforestation and population structure.
The preparation of the Nutrition Soil of beech tree Seedling Stage is to be all generally rich in soil ulmin at present, and venting and water permeable is good, has certain water conservation, fertilizer conservation effect soil for basic.Common composition is: the mixing such as field table soil, vegetable mould, sandy soil, organic fertilizer, each composition stirs.
On reality plantation, common Nutrition Soil recipe ratio effect more single and that play is not fairly obvious at present.
Summary of the invention
Goal of the invention: to set common Nutrition Soil recipe ratio more single in order to solve in prior art existing beech, the unconspicuous problem of the effect that rises, the present invention proposes a kind ofly can promote that beech trees takes root rapidly, Nutrition Soil that is applicable to the sowing of beech tree non-woven fabrics of fast-growing and preparation method thereof.
Technical scheme: to achieve these objectives, the present invention takes following technical scheme:
Be applicable to the Nutrition Soil that beech tree non-woven fabrics is grown seedlings, its formula comprises the component of following weight percent: native 30-40% is shown in described field, vegetable mould 10-20%, agricultural crop straw 10-25%, sandy soil 5-25%, organic fertilizer 10-15%, calcium superphosphate 2-3%, Dry chick faeces 2-3%.
Further, described agricultural crop straw is powdery.
Further, the fermented mixture that described organic fertilizer is specially soybean cake powder, bacterium slag and feces of livestock and poultry is made.
Further, the weight ratio of the mixture of described soybean cake powder, bacterium slag and feces of livestock and poultry is 1:1:3-1:1:5.
Further, the fermentation process of described organic fertilizer is soybean cake powder, bacterium slag and the feces of livestock and poultry that first takes required weight, builds heap fermentation, and in heap, temperature reaches 42-48 DEG C of turning once, turning 6 times altogether, fermentation ends.
A making method that is applicable to the Nutrition Soil that beech trees non-woven fabrics grows seedlings, comprises the following steps:
(1) get each component according to the formula of Nutrition Soil, each component is mixed thoroughly;
(2) Nutrition Soil of mixing thoroughly is packed in non-woven fabrics nutrition pot, will be positioned at the Nutrition Soil compacting of non-woven fabrics nutrition pot bottom, Nutrition Soil is filled to from nutrition pot mouth 3-4cm place, and each nutrition pot is broadcast earthing after a seed;
(3) nutrition pot orderliness is entered in whole good furrow, sprays water after sequencing non-woven fabrics nutrition pot, allow seed and soil fully in conjunction with.

Embodiment
Embodiment 1:
A kind of beech that are applicable to are set the Nutrition Soil that non-woven fabrics is grown seedlings, configure 1000 kilograms of special nutrient soils, its formula comprises the component of following weight percent: field table soil 30%, vegetable mould 10%, agricultural crop straw (powdery) 20%, sandy soil 25%, organic fertilizer 10%, calcium superphosphate 3%, Dry chick faeces 2%.Wherein, organic fertilizer is the product obtaining by after soybean cake powder, bacterium slag and fowl and animal excrement fermentation, and the weight ratio between described soybean cake powder, bacterium slag and fowl and animal excrement is 1:1:5; The making method of this organic fertilizer is as follows: first take according to the weight ratio between soybean cake powder, bacterium slag and fowl and animal excrement, then build heap fermentation, in heap, temperature reaches 48 DEG C of turnings once, and turning 6 times, obtains required organic fertilizer after fermentation ends altogether.
A making method for the Nutrition Soil that above-mentioned apocarya non-woven fabrics is grown seedlings, comprises the following steps:
(1) take each component according to the formula of Nutrition Soil, each component is mixed thoroughly;
(2) Nutrition Soil of mixing thoroughly is packed in non-woven fabrics nutrition pot, will be positioned at the Nutrition Soil compacting of non-woven fabrics nutrition pot bottom, Nutrition Soil is filled to from nutrition pot mouth 3cm place, and each nutrition pot is broadcast earthing after an apocarya seed;
(3) nutrition pot orderliness is entered in whole good furrow, sprays water after sequencing non-woven fabrics nutrition pot, allow seed and soil fully in conjunction with.

In April, 2013-2014 year June, researchist selects beech tree nursery in blocks on rear white farm and tests, in early April, 2013 processes Zelkova schneideriana seeds, make Nutrition Soil according to Nutrition Soil formula and the making method of embodiment 1-4 successively, adopt respectively above-mentioned Nutrition Soil to process Zelkova schneideriana seeds; In addition increase traditional control group test, use field soil directly as Nutrition Soil, Zelkova schneideriana seeds to be processed.In by the end of June, 2014, and percentage of germination, seedling rate and transplanting survival rate are carried out to Observe and measure; Concrete test-results is as shown in the table:
Can find out from the data results of upper table, use the present invention to be applicable to Nutrition Soil that beech trees non-woven fabrics grows seedlings and preparation method thereof, compared with prior art percentage of germination, seedling rate, rooting rate and transplanting survival rate obviously increase, the formula of Nutrition Soil of the present invention is rationally comprehensive, promotes rapidly the growth of seed germination and seedling; Apocarya seedling there is is certain strong sprout, takes root rapidly, resists disease and pest effect; In addition, use the method for Nutrition Soil cultivation apocarya of the present invention simple, cost is low, uses conveniently, is easy to promote.
